条件运算符(?:)和 $替代string.Format()
1. 条件运算符(?:)根据Boolean表达式的值返回两个值之一。表达式如下:
condition ? first_expression : second_expression
2. $""替代String.Format()方法,""中包含字符,有变量的需要用{}括起:
举例
if (bonus==false)
return "¥"+salary.ToString();
elase
return "¥"+(salary*10).ToString();
可以由如下代码替换:
return bonus ? string.Format("¥{0}",salary*10):string.Format("¥{0}",salary); //String.Format()方法
或
return bonus ? $"¥{salary*10}":$"¥{salary}"; //$""的用法
转载于:https://www.cnblogs.com/xiao9426926/p/5821841.html
条件运算符(?:)和 $替代string.Format()相关推荐
- sql string转number_少用 string.Format
如果你使用的是 C# 6.0 及其以上版本的话我建议你使用新增的 *内插字符串* 这个功能.这个功能可以更好的帮助开发人员设置字符串格式.下面我们就来看一下为什么要少用 string.Format 而 ...
- Java / Android String.format 的使用
String类的format()方法用于创建格式化的字符串以及连接多个字符串对象. 自己使用的地方1 拼接字符串 2 ,多语言文字顺序不同问题,例如中文:距离到公司还有30分钟, 时间是接口获取的, ...
- android String.format
资源创建: <!-- 多参数验证 --> <string name="text">截止到:%1$tc\n销售量比去年增长了%2$d%%\n在这里我对 ...
- String.Format格式说明
C#格式化数值结果表 字符 说明 示例 输出 C 货币 string.Format("{0:C3}", 2) $2.000 D 十进制 string.Format("{0 ...
- String.Format()方法
String.Format方法是我们在.Net应用开发时经常使用到的,它的灵活使用有时能够达到事半功倍的效果,下面我们就借用MSDN上的一个示例来向大家展示String.Format的各种用法. 该示 ...
- ASP.NET设置数据格式与String.Format使用总结
{0:d} YY-MM-DD {0:p} 百分比00.00% {0:N2} 12.68 {0:N0} 13 {0:c2} $12.68 {0:d} 3/23/2003 {0:T} 12:00:00 ...
- String.format()【演示具体的例子来说明】
String.format()[演示样例具体解释] 整理者:Vashon 前言: String.format 作为文本处理工具.为我们提供强大而丰富的字符串格式化功能,为了不止步于简单调用 Strin ...
- C#:String.Format数字格式化输出
C#:String.Format数字格式化输出 int a = 12345678; //格式为sring输出 // Label1.Text = string.Format("asd ...
- Java String.format() : 字符串格式化
2019独角兽企业重金招聘Python工程师标准>>> 1.常规类型的格式化 String类的format()方法用于创建格式化的字符串以及连接多个字符串对象. 1.format(S ...
最新文章
- python3中的新式类与经典类对比
- 一点历史--Python
- Linux下查看文件占用空间大小的du 和df 命令
- java中如何合并两个网格_java – 如何在GXT中合并网格单元格
- jdbc连接数据scanip_java数据库连接_jdbc
- 解题报告:hdu 1276 士兵队列训练问题 - 简单题
- storm apache_Apache Storm的实时情绪分析示例
- 幂集 返回某集合的所有子集
- 数字图像处理基础与应用 第四章
- css页面布局的感想,css布局实践感想(示例代码)
- java arraylist 合并_在Java中将两个arrayList合并到一个新的arrayList中,没有重复且没有顺序...
- [安卓]AndroidManifest.xml文件简介及结构
- Leecode刷题热题HOT100(5)——最长回文子串
- 浅析foreach原理
- 松下plc驱动VF0变频器_2021厦门松下伺服马达回收现金回收
- 卓越、当当、京东三大广告联盟比较
- Directx11教程(60) tessellation学习(2)
- pc游戏手柄测试软件,《原神》PC版技术性开发测试,游戏手柄操作更佳爽快
- 三线摆法测刚体转动惯量实验结论_关于刚体转动的前概念研究
- 订单量排行 php,订单量增速最快B2C电商未来电子商务的趋势网站